Position Title: LUNCHTIME SUPERVISOR
Company: City Of Durham
Location:Durham, England, UK
Job Description
Durham County Council is an Equal Opportunities Employer. We want to develop a more diverse workforce and we positively welcome applications from all sections of the community.
Responsibilities:
• Supervise children outdoors
• Organise and implementing outside games and activities to encourage enjoyment at lunchtime.
• Set and maintaining high standards of behaviour within the schools behaviour policies.
• Respond to the different needs and interests of children.
• Organise activities for wet playtimes.
• Working closely with lunchtime colleagues.
• Good communication skills with pupils and other school staff.
•To interact positively and establish good relationships with all children and other staff as necessary.
• To ensure children enjoy lunchtime, healthy eating and a relaxed, engaging environment.
• To promote and support a whole school approach to inclusive play.
• To support all children and school staff as necessary.
• At all times to work within the school’s policies with regard to: Behaviour Management, Equal Opportunities, Safeguarding, Health & Safety, Anti-Bullying, Confidentiality, Risk Management.
• To carry out responsibilities under the direction and guidance of the post’s manager.
• To support and supervise children in the dining room, playground, corridors, toilets or other areas during lunchtime depending on the timetable and rota established.
• To always listen to children’s concerns and respond appropriately.
• To deal with difficult or challenging behaviour by pupils in a calm and professional way.
• To be alert for children who are at risk of bullying or being
bullied and intervene in disputes be they physical or verbal as necessary.
• To ensure that all children who suffer any injury or accident are dealt with appropriately and in accordance with the school’s agreed procedures.
• To report any serious concerns regarding children’s welfare or behaviour to the Class Teacher(s) and/or Teaching Assistant(s) as and when they arise, and to inform the Senior Leadership Team as necessary.
• Assisting where necessary in ensuring that all those who are on the premises at lunchtime have authority to be there.
